Default How to get RC injectors to fit stock rail?

I am doing a minor build up for my 97 teg, details to come later, and I will be running 440cc RCs for the injectors. How do I get them to fit the stock rail? I have an AEM rail but I don't want to use it unless I have to. The fit the AM rail with no problems but where they would go to the stock rail there is a plastic piece.

Default Re: How to get RC injectors to fit stock rail? (NUISANCE)

They do fit the stock rail. You need different o-rings for the intake manifold. Go to the parts store and get some thicker ones. I know that the ones for a 2001 GSXR 1000 will work with the RC injectors.
